Gramática

Incorrect order of adjectives

× Yes, I often make a list the when I shop because making a list allows me to remember all important things I want to buy and never forget anything important and it will make my life stay organized and prioritize items.

Yes, I often make a list when I shop because making a list allows me to remember all the important things I want to buy and never forget anything important, and it helps me stay organized and prioritize items.

The phrase 'the when I shop' contains an incorrect article placement; 'the' should be removed. Also, 'all important things' should be 'all the important things' to correctly use the definite article with adjectives. Additionally, 'it will make my life stay organized' is awkward; 'it helps me stay organized' is more natural. The sentence is long and needs commas to separate ideas clearly.

Incorrect use of prepositions

× Maybe some people don't like making lists because they feel restricted by having to follow a fixed plan. They prefer do things spontaneously because it makes them feel more free and more relaxed.

Maybe some people don't like making lists because they feel restricted by having to follow a fixed plan. They prefer to do things spontaneously because it makes them feel freer and more relaxed.

The verb 'prefer' should be followed by 'to' before the base verb, so 'prefer do' is incorrect; it should be 'prefer to do'. Also, 'more free' is better expressed as 'freer' when comparing states, so 'feel freer' is correct.
